Output d11eedf66f42b00c6c84c4152300f7ca85de91b8cd02c3a5d80abad6a0d05ac4:25

value
299576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b6c3629518eb6a5390b6e927c59b66bc488f38 OP_EQUAL
address
3Ghwgce7iESRccwy3NyfFRGT5Eg29KDna3
transaction
d11eedf66f42b00c6c84c4152300f7ca85de91b8cd02c3a5d80abad6a0d05ac4
spent
true